Getting Connected

Before handling any user request, establish a connection to the backend API. Show a brief status like "Connecting...".

If NEMO_TOKEN is in the environment, use it directly and create a session. Otherwise, acquire a free starter token:

  • Generate a UUID as client identifier
  • POST to https://mega-api-prod.nemovideo.ai/api/auth/anonymous-token with the X-Client-Id header
  • The response includes a token with 100 free credits valid for 7 days — use it as NEMO_TOKEN

Then create a session by POSTing to https://mega-api-prod.nemovideo.ai/api/tasks/me/with-session/nemo_agent with Bearer authorization and body {"task_name":"project","language":"en"}. The session_id in the response is needed for all following requests.

Tell the user you're ready. Keep the technical details out of the chat.

Cloud Render Pipeline Details

Each export job queues on a cloud GPU node that composites video layers, applies platform-spec compression (H.264, up to 1080x1920), and returns a download URL within 30-90 seconds. The session token carries render job IDs, so closing the tab before completion orphans the job.

All calls go to https://mega-api-prod.nemovideo.ai. The main endpoints:

  1. SessionPOST /api/tasks/me/with-session/nemo_agent with {"task_name":"project","language":"\x3Clang>"}. Gives you a session_id.
  2. Chat (SSE)POST /run_sse with session_id and your message in new_message.parts[0].text. Set Accept: text/event-stream. Up to 15 min.
  3. UploadPOST /api/upload-video/nemo_agent/me/\x3Csid> — multipart file or JSON with URLs.
  4. CreditsGET /api/credits/balance/simple — returns available, frozen, total.
  5. StateGET /api/state/nemo_agent/me/\x3Csid>/latest — current draft and media info.
  6. ExportPOST /api/render/proxy/lambda with render ID and draft JSON. Poll GET /api/render/proxy/lambda/\x3Cid> every 30s for completed status and download URL.

Formats: mp4, mov, avi, webm, mkv, jpg, png, gif, webp, mp3, wav, m4a, aac.

Skill attribution — read from this file's YAML frontmatter at runtime:

  • X-Skill-Source: image-to-video-online-ai
  • X-Skill-Version: from frontmatter version
  • X-Skill-Platform: detect from install path (~/.clawhub/clawhub, ~/.cursor/skills/cursor, else unknown)

Every API call needs Authorization: Bearer \x3CNEMO_TOKEN> plus the three attribution headers above. If any header is missing, exports return 402.

Draft JSON uses short keys: t for tracks, tt for track type (0=video, 1=audio, 7=text), sg for segments, d for duration in ms, m for metadata.

Error Handling

Code Meaning Action
0 Success Continue
1001 Bad/expired token Re-auth via anonymous-token (tokens expire after 7 days)
1002 Session not found New session §3.0
2001 No credits Anonymous: show registration URL with ?bind=\x3Cid> (get \x3Cid> from create-session or state response when needed). Registered: "Top up credits in your account"
4001 Unsupported file Show supported formats
4002 File too large Suggest compress/trim
400 Missing X-Client-Id Generate Client-Id and retry (see §1)
402 Free plan export blocked Subscription tier issue, NOT credits. "Register or upgrade your plan to unlock export."
429 Rate limit (1 token/client/7 days) Retry in 30s once

安全使用建议
This skill mostly does what it says: it will call a remote nemovideo.ai API to create videos and needs a NEMO_TOKEN (or it will request an anonymous token for you). Before installing, consider: 1) Are you comfortable the agent will make network calls to https://mega-api-prod.nemovideo.ai and potentially obtain an anonymous token automatically? 2) The skill asks the agent to read this skill file's frontmatter and probe common install paths (e.g., ~/.clawhub, ~/.cursor/skills) to set attribution headers — if you prefer the agent not to read your home-directory paths, avoid installing or ask the developer to remove that behavior. 3) There's an inconsistency between the SKILL.md frontmatter (which mentions ~/.config/nemovideo/) and the registry metadata — ask the author to clarify why that config path is needed or remove it. If you proceed, provide only the minimum credential you trust (or let the skill use an anonymous token) and monitor what it returns/downloads. If you want higher assurance, request the developer publish a source/homepage and explain the configPath/platform-detection logic in writing.

能力评估
Purpose & Capability
The skill's stated purpose (server-side image→video rendering) matches the API calls and the single required credential (NEMO_TOKEN). However, the SKILL.md frontmatter includes a configPaths entry (~/.config/nemovideo/) that is unnecessary for a purely remote API-based workflow and contradicts the registry metadata (which lists no required config paths).
Instruction Scope
Instructions require creating sessions, uploading files, and using SSE to drive edits — all expected. But they also instruct the agent to read this file's YAML frontmatter and detect the skill platform by checking install paths (e.g., ~/.clawhub/, ~/.cursor/skills/). Detecting arbitrary install paths / home-directory locations and hiding technical details from users are scope-creep / transparency concerns because they require filesystem access not obviously needed to convert images.
Install Mechanism
Instruction-only skill with no install spec or downloaded code — low install risk. Nothing is written to disk by an installer in the provided metadata.
Credentials
Only NEMO_TOKEN is declared as required, which is proportional. But the instructions will create an anonymous token when NEMO_TOKEN is absent (calling an external API automatically). The frontmatter's configPaths declaration (which is inconsistent with registry metadata) suggests additional config file access that isn't justified by the skill's purpose.
Persistence & Privilege
Skill is not always-on and does not request persistent system privileges. The only extra privilege-like action is reading the skill file/frontmatter and probing common install paths to set an attribution header — this is limited but should be noted.
